Classical Male Nude Painting, After the Antique

 Inspired by Wounded Achilles Oil on Canvas, Contemporary This exceptional en grisaille oil on canvas figurative painting is inspired by the celebrated neoclassical sculpture Wounded Achilles by Innocenzo Fraccaroli, translating one of antiquity’s most expressive heroic forms into a luminous painted work. 


The composition presents the male figure in a dramatic contrapposto, helmeted and partially draped, with an arrow embedded in the leg—an iconic reference to Achilles at the moment of vulnerability. The artist renders the anatomy with disciplined academic draftsmanship, emphasizing sculptural clarity, balance, and proportion. 


Subtle tonal modeling and restrained color transitions evoke the tactile presence of carved marble, while the softly modulated neutral background heightens the figure’s elegance and timeless gravity. Rooted in the tradition of classical and neoclassical art, this painting bridges sculpture and painting, antiquity and contemporary craftsmanship.
